Why revenue operations breaks when finance remains downstream
Many SaaS organizations still run revenue operations as a sequence of departmental events. Sales closes a deal, finance interprets the contract, operations provisions service, customer success manages adoption and leadership tries to reconcile metrics later. This downstream finance model creates friction in discount approvals, billing exceptions, contract amendments, usage reconciliation, collections timing and renewal forecasting. The result is not just inefficiency. It is strategic opacity. Leaders cannot easily see which pricing models scale, which customer segments are profitable, where onboarding delays affect cash flow or how infrastructure costs influence margin by plan, tenant or partner channel.
A finance-embedded model changes the design principle. Revenue operations starts with financial logic built into the commercial workflow. Product packaging, contract terms, subscription operations, service delivery milestones, partner commissions, tax treatment, invoicing cadence and renewal triggers are defined as part of one governed system. This is especially important for businesses offering White-label ERP, OEM Platforms, managed services or partner-led SaaS because the commercial model often includes reseller tiers, delegated support, branded portals, shared responsibilities and infrastructure-based pricing.
What a finance-embedded SaaS model actually includes
A finance-embedded SaaS model is not limited to accounting automation. It is an operating model where commercial events automatically create financial, operational and customer lifecycle actions. A quote should influence provisioning rules. A subscription change should update billing, margin assumptions and support entitlements. A failed payment should trigger collections workflow, customer communication and risk review. A renewal opportunity should reflect product usage, service history and outstanding commercial obligations. When these events are orchestrated in one architecture, revenue operations becomes measurable and scalable.
- Commercial alignment: pricing, packaging, discount governance, contract structure and partner terms are standardized before scale introduces exceptions.
- Operational alignment: onboarding, provisioning, service activation, support entitlements and renewal workflows are tied to subscription status and customer lifecycle milestones.
- Financial alignment: invoicing, collections, deferred revenue logic, cost visibility and profitability analysis are embedded into the same transaction flow.
Choosing the right monetization model for operational reality
Revenue operations alignment depends heavily on monetization design. Many SaaS firms choose pricing models based on market messaging rather than delivery economics. That creates friction later when finance and operations must support exceptions. Finance-embedded design starts by asking which pricing model best matches service delivery, customer value realization and infrastructure consumption. Subscription fees, usage-based charges, implementation fees, support tiers, partner revenue shares and managed hosting charges should all map cleanly into the operating model.
| Model | Best fit | Operational implication | Finance implication |
|---|---|---|---|
| Per-user subscription | Role-based applications with measurable seat adoption | Requires license governance and user lifecycle controls | Simple billing but can create friction in enterprise expansion |
| Unlimited-user subscription | Enterprise-wide adoption and process standardization | Supports broad rollout and lower internal procurement friction | Shifts focus to contract value, service scope and retention outcomes |
| Infrastructure-based pricing | Managed cloud, dedicated SaaS and high-variability workloads | Needs monitoring, capacity planning and cost allocation discipline | Improves margin visibility when linked to hosting and support costs |
| Hybrid subscription plus services | Complex onboarding, integration-heavy or regulated environments | Requires milestone tracking and cross-functional delivery governance | Improves revenue planning when services and recurring streams are coordinated |
Unlimited-user business models can be especially effective where the strategic goal is process adoption across departments rather than seat monetization. In SaaS ERP and Cloud ERP environments, broad usage often improves data quality, workflow completion and reporting consistency. However, unlimited-user pricing only works when the platform architecture, support model and contract governance can absorb enterprise-wide scale without uncontrolled service costs.

Architecture decisions that shape margin, resilience and governance
Finance-embedded SaaS strategy succeeds only when the architecture supports the business model. Multi-tenant SaaS is often the most efficient option for standardized offerings, partner ecosystems and recurring revenue at scale because it centralizes operations, simplifies upgrades and improves unit economics. Dedicated SaaS or private cloud deployment becomes more appropriate when customers require stronger isolation, custom integration boundaries, regional control or stricter governance. Hybrid cloud deployment can support phased modernization, regulated workloads or mixed customer requirements across shared and isolated environments.
From an enterprise architecture perspective, the decision should not be framed as technology preference alone. It should be tied to pricing strategy, support obligations, compliance posture and service-level commitments. A cloud-native stack may include Kubernetes and Docker for orchestration and portability, PostgreSQL for transactional integrity, Redis for performance-sensitive caching, Object Storage for documents and backups, and Reverse Proxy plus Load Balancing for secure traffic management. Horizontal Scaling, Autoscaling and High Availability matter when subscription growth, partner onboarding or seasonal billing cycles create variable demand. These are not infrastructure details in isolation. They directly affect gross margin, customer experience and renewal confidence.
Embedding governance, security and continuity into the revenue model
When finance is embedded into SaaS operations, governance must also be embedded. Identity and Access Management should reflect commercial roles, approval authority, partner boundaries and segregation of duties. Cloud Governance should define who can provision environments, approve integrations, change pricing logic or access financial data. Enterprise Security should cover tenant isolation, encryption, secrets management, vulnerability management and auditability. Monitoring, Observability, Logging and Alerting should not be treated as technical extras. They are essential for billing integrity, service assurance and incident response.
Business continuity is equally commercial. Disaster Recovery and backup strategy determine how quickly the business can restore subscription operations, customer records, invoices and support workflows after disruption. For managed hosting strategy, leaders should define recovery priorities based on revenue-critical processes first: order capture, provisioning, billing, collections and customer support. This is where self-managed cloud, Odoo.sh, managed cloud services and dedicated SaaS deployments should be evaluated pragmatically. The right choice depends on required control, internal platform engineering maturity, compliance needs and the value of outsourced operational resilience.
Designing onboarding, success and retention as financial workflows
Customer onboarding strategy is often discussed as a service issue, but in finance-embedded SaaS it is a revenue realization issue. Delayed onboarding postpones adoption, increases support burden and weakens renewal probability. The best operating models define onboarding milestones, acceptance criteria, billing triggers, training obligations and escalation paths before the contract is signed. Customer success strategy should then be tied to measurable lifecycle events such as activation, usage depth, support trends, expansion readiness and renewal timing. Customer retention strategy becomes stronger when finance, support and account teams share one view of account health rather than separate dashboards.
- Map each lifecycle stage to a financial outcome: contract activation, first invoice, service go-live, adoption threshold, renewal review and expansion trigger.
- Automate handoffs across sales, delivery, finance and support using APIs and workflow automation rather than manual status updates.
- Use business intelligence to identify margin erosion, delayed onboarding, chronic support exceptions and renewal risk by segment, partner or deployment model.
Platform engineering and DevOps as revenue operations enablers
For enterprise SaaS, platform engineering is now part of commercial scalability. If every new customer, partner tenant or dedicated environment requires manual setup, revenue growth will eventually outpace operational capacity. Infrastructure as Code, CI/CD and GitOps help standardize environment creation, policy enforcement, release management and rollback discipline. API-first architecture supports integration with CRM, payment systems, tax engines, support platforms, identity providers and data warehouses. Workflow automation reduces dependency on spreadsheets and email approvals that often create billing delays and audit gaps.
AI-ready SaaS architecture also matters, but it should be approached as an operational capability rather than a marketing label. Clean transactional data, governed APIs, consistent event models and reliable observability create the foundation for AI-assisted ERP use cases such as anomaly detection in billing, support triage, forecasting support demand, contract risk review or workflow recommendations. Without disciplined data and process design, AI adds noise rather than value.
